The cost of living difference between Holyoke, MA and Lynnfield, MA is dramatic. Holyoke is 53.1% cheaper than Lynnfield,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Holyoke has a cost index of 86 while Lynnfield sits at 184,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

On the housing front, median rent in Holyoke is $1,016/month compared to $2,333/month in Lynnfield — a 57%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Holyoke is more affordable at $255,300 median vs $904,200.

Median household income in Holyoke is $51,892 compared to $172,484 in Lynnfield (-69.9%). While Lynnfield is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Holyoke spend roughly 23.5% of their income on rent, more than the 16.2% in Lynnfield.

Climate-wise, both cities share similar average temperatures (49.4°F vs 49.9°F). Holyoke receives more rainfall at 45.2" per year compared to 44.9" in Lynnfield.
